    Artículo escrito por un elevado número de autores, solo se referencian el que aparece en primer lugar, el nombre del grupo de colaboración, si le hubiere, y los autores pertenecientes a la UAMThe Late Cretaceous (Campanian-Maastrichtian) fossil site of Lo Hueco was recently discovered close to the village of Fuentes (Cuenca, Spain) during the cutting of a little hill for installation of the railway of the Madrid-Levante high-speed train. To date, it has yielded a rich collection of well-preserved Cretaceous macrofossils, including plants, invertebrates, and vertebrates. The recovered fossil assemblage is mainly composed of plants, molluscs (bivalves and gastropods), actinopterygians and teleosteans fishes, amphibians, panpleurodiran (bothremydids) and pancryptodiran turtles, squamate lizards, eusuchian crocodyliforms, rhabdodontid ornithopods, theropods (mainly dromaeosaurids), and titanosaur sauropods. This assemblage was deposited in a near-coast continental muddy floodplain crossed by distributary sandy channels, exposed intermittently to brackish or marine and freshwater flooding as well as to partial or total desiccation events. The Konzentrat-Lagerstatt of Lo Hueco constitutes a singular accumulation of fossils representing individuals of some particular lineages of continental tetrapods, especially titanosaurs, eusuchians and bothremydid turtles. In the case of the titanosaurs, the site has yielded multiple partial skeletons in anatomical connection or with a low dispersion of their skeletal elements. A combination of new taxa, new records of taxa previously known in the Iberian Peninsula, and relatively common taxa in the European record compose the Lo Hueco biota. The particular conditions of the fossil site of Lo Hueco and the preliminary results indicate that the analysis of the geological context, the floral and faunal content, and the taphonomical features of the site provide elements that will be especially useful for reassess the evolutionary history of some lineages of European Late Cretaceous reptilesThe fieldwork at Lo Hueco (2007-2009) was funded by ADIF (the state-owned company that administrate the Spanish railway infrastructures) through the company awarded the civil works (Ferrovial).     Microwave heating presents a faster, lower energy synthetic methodology for the realization of functional materials. Here, we demonstrate for the first time that employing this method also leads to a decrease in the occurrence of defects in olivine structured LiFe1−xMnxPO4. For example, the presence of antisite defects in this structure precludes Li+ diffusion along the b-axis leading to a significant decrease in reversible capacities. Total scattering measurements, in combination with Li+ diffusion studies using muon spin relaxation (μ+SR) spectroscopy, reveal that this synthetic method generates fewer defects in the nanostructures compared to traditional solvothermal routes. Our interest in developing these routes to mixed-metal phosphate LiFe1−xMnxPO4 olivines is due to the higher Mn2+/3+ redox potential in comparison to the Fe2+/3+ pair. Here, single-phase LiFe1−xMnxPO4 (x = 0, 0.25, 0.5, 0.75 and 1) olivines have been prepared following a microwave-assisted approach which allows for up to 4 times faster reaction times compared to traditional solvothermal methods. Interestingly, the resulting particle morphology is dependent on the Mn content. We also examine their electrochemical performance as active electrodes in Li-ion batteries. These results present microwave routes as highly attractive for reproducible, gram-scale syntheses of high quality nanostructured electrodes which display close to theoretical capacity for the full iron phase

    En el verano de 1980 defendí la tesis doctoral en Teología en la que había trabajado bajo la dirección del Prof. Dr. Juan Belda Plans a la que puse por título Algunas cuestiones en torno a la infalibilidad pontificia y conciliar en Melchor Cano. Se trataba del estudio de cinco cuestiones eclesiológicas elaboradas por el maestro salmantino en su célebre tratado sobre el método teológico: De locis theologicis, a la manera de un excursus dentro del Libro V, (capítulo 5°) de esa obra, correspondiente al estudio de la autoridad de los Concilios generales como lugar teológico (después de la Sagrada Escritura, las Tradiciones Apostólicas y la Iglesia Universal). Las cinco cuestiones tenían en común la pertenencia al tema de los Concilios Universales: 1) si el Concilio realizado con la asistencia de los legados del Sumo Pontífice tiene autoridad firme y cierta, o más bien hay que esperar la confirmación del Obispo de Roma; 2) si los Padres del Concilio son verdaderos jueces, o sólo consejeros; 3) si las definiciones de un Concilio aprobado por el Papa pertenecen a la Sagrada Escritura; 4) con qué método y criterio averiguar cuáles decretos de los Concilios son ciertos en materia de Fe (infalibilidad in fide); 5) si los Concilios pueden errar en materia de costumbres (infalibilidad in moribus). Habiendo ya sido estudiada la cuestión tercera en otra tesis elaborada en el seno de este proyecto, mi trabajo se centró en las cuatro restantes. Por lo que se refiere a la cuestión teológica que ahora se publica, «sobre si los padres conciliares son verdaderos jueces de la fe», en ella se pone de manifiesto que Melchor Cano es un precedente destacado de la posterior evolución eclesiológica, en temas como la naturaleza del episcopado y su carácter sacramental, la colegialidad episcopal, la existencia de dos titulares inadecuadamente distintos de la suprema potestad en la Iglesia: el Papa y el Concilio ecuménico, que incluye al Papa como su Cabeza. Al desarrollar la cuestión, nuestro teólogo muestra cómo ejercita él mismo su propio método teológico teorizado en su obra magna, dando luces para la prosecución del estudio de este tema, que sigue siendo de actualidad

    We investigate the synthesis of continuous-variable two-mode unitary gates in the setting where two modes A and B are coupled by a fixed quadratic Hamiltonian H. The gate synthesis consists of a sequence of evolutions governed by Hamiltonian H interspaced by local phase shifts applied to A and B. We concentrate on protocols that require the minimum necessary number of steps and we show how to implement the beam splitter and the two-mode squeezer in just three steps. Particular attention is paid to the Hamiltonian x_A p_B that describes the effective off-resonant interaction of light with the collective atomic spin.Comment: 7 pages, minor text modifications, references adde

    What is the time-optimal way of using a set of control Hamiltonians to obtain a desired interaction? Vidal, Hammerer and Cirac [Phys. Rev. Lett. 88 (2002) 237902] have obtained a set of powerful results characterizing the time-optimal simulation of a two-qubit quantum gate using a fixed interaction Hamiltonian and fast local control over the individual qubits. How practically useful are these results? We prove that there are two-qubit Hamiltonians such that time-optimal simulation requires infinitely many steps of evolution, each infinitesimally small, and thus is physically impractical. A procedure is given to determine which two-qubit Hamiltonians have this property, and we show that almost all Hamiltonians do. Finally, we determine some bounds on the penalty that must be paid in the simulation time if the number of steps is fixed at a finite number, and show that the cost in simulation time is not too great.Comment: 9 pages, 2 figure

    The influence of energy restriction (ER) on muscle is controversial, and the mechanisms are not well understood. To study the effect of ER on skeletal muscle phenotype and the influence of vitamin D, rats (n = 34) were fed a control diet or an ER diet. Muscle mass, muscle somatic index (MSI), fiber-type composition, fiber size, and metabolic activity were studied in tibialis cranialis (TC) and soleus (SOL) muscles. Plasma vitamin D metabolites and renal expression of enzymes involved in vitamin D metabolism were measured. In the ER group, muscle weight was unchanged in TC and decreased by 12% in SOL, but MSI increased in both muscles (p < 0.0001) by 55% and 36%, respectively. Histomorphometric studies showed 14% increase in the percentage of type IIA fibers and 13% reduction in type IIX fibers in TC of ER rats. Decreased size of type I fibers and reduced oxidative activity was identified in SOL of ER rats. An increase in plasma 1,25(OH)2-vitamin D (169.7 ± 6.8 vs. 85.4 ± 11.5 pg/mL, p < 0.0001) with kidney up-regulation of CYP27b1 and down-regulation of CYP24a1 was observed in ER rats. Plasma vitamin D correlated with MSI in both muscles (p < 0.001), with the percentages of type IIA and type IIX fibers in TC and with the oxidative profile in SOL. In conclusion, ER preserves skeletal muscle mass, improves contractile phenotype in phasic muscles (TC), and reduces energy expenditure in antigravity muscles (SOL). These beneficial effects are closely related to the increases in vitamin D secondary to ER

    [Abstract] Aims:  The aim of this study was to describe the degree of compliance of agreed practices with reference to primary care patients with Type 2 diabetes of 40 years old and older in Galicia (NW Spain). Methods:  A total of 108 primary care physicians were selected at random from the totality of doctors. Each physician selected 30 patients at random from their patients suffering from diabetes of 40 years old or older. External observers gathered information from each patient’s medical record regarding their characteristics, condition and degree of compliance of selected indicators of good practice. Results:  Group of physicians participated in this study had a mean age of 50 years (standard deviation = 3.9); 48% of them were females; and 17.5% involved in medical residents training. A total of 3078 diabetic patients were included in the study: mean age = 69 years (SD = 10.9), 47.6% women, presence of high blood pressure (72%), hypercholesterolaemia (56%), and regular smokers (10.3%). Compliance with selected indicators such as foot examination (14%), ophthalmological examination (30.6%), abdominal circumference measurement (6.1%), measurement of total or LDL-cholesterol (78.1), blood pressure measurement (84.8), glycosylated haemoglobin measurement < 7% (54.3%) was observed. Adequate monitoring in cases of high blood pressure and hypercholesterolaemia were 34.2% and 27.4%, respectively. Variability between physicians differs according to the different indicators, with interquartile range for compliance of between 16.4 and 66%. Conclusions:  There is a wide margin for improvement in the adaptation of clinical practice to recommendations for diabetic patients. The large variation existing in certain indicators would suggest that certain control objectives are less demanding than advisable in those that comply least, while low compliance and low variability in other indicators point to structural problems or unsatisfactory training of doctors
